Watertown is a city located in Carver County, Minnesota. Watertown has a 2026 population of 4,774. Watertown is currently declining at a rate of -0.54% annually but its population has increased by 1.9%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 4,685 in 2020.
The median household income in Watertown is $99,671 with a poverty rate of 7.73%. The median age in Watertown is 33.3 years: 34.3 years for males, and 32.3 years for females. For every 100 females there are 98.4 males.

The racial composition of Watertown includes 92.57% White, and smaller percentages for other race, Asian, Black or African American, Native American and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
|---|---|---|
| White | 4,434 | 92.57% |
| Two or more races | 294 | 6.14% |
| Other race | 40 | 0.84% |
| Asian | 16 | 0.33% |
| Black or African American | 3 | 0.06% |
| Native American | 3 | 0.06% |
Watertown's average per capita income is $56,971. Household income levels show a median of $99,671. The poverty rate stands at 7.73%.
Name | Median |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$153,810 | - |
| Families | $117,388 | $128,410 |
| Households | $99,671 | $114,968 |
| Non Families | $73,636 | $69,384 |
